About PQA Maidstone, Rochester and Tunbridge Wells
PQA offers performing arts sessions to children, every Saturday, based at The Skinner’s Kent Academy, combining acting, singing, dancing lessons, filming, and comedy.
Our weekly sessions include Comedy & Drama, Musical Theatre and Film & Television for children and young people aged 4-18. At PQA Tunbridge Wells, we are passionate about giving children the space to be themselves, learn new skills, make new friends, all in a safe and welcome environment while they explore the world of Performing Arts. From Musical Theatre, to Comedy and Drama and Film & TV, there is something for everyone at PQA!
The best part, there is no need to pick just one class, PQA’s weekly three-hour sessions explore:
• Comedy & Drama class: your child will learn creative play, Improv and scriptwriting
• Musical Theatre class: your child will learn to sing, dance and act for theatre
• Film & Television class: your child will start to storyboard, screenwrite, film and act for television
